Understanding the Shift Toward Personalized Digital Topographies
Historically, maps served as static references—reliable but inflexible. Today, however, the emphasis has shifted toward dynamic digital topographies that adapt instantaneously to user needs and environmental factors. This transition is driven by breakthroughs in mobile technology, geospatial data analytics, and AI-powered personalization.
For instance, navigation apps like Google Maps and Waze have incorporated real-time traffic updates, but their scope remains largely standardized. The next frontier involves creating layered, customizable maps that reflect individual priorities—be it accessibility, safety, scenic routes, or local hotspots—delivered seamlessly on mobile devices.
